Hay Creek Research Natural Area
Ecological and Physical Description
Hay Creek RNA includes the headwater, spring-fed stream system of the Middle Fork of Hay Creek and its two tributaries; the topographic relief of the Bear Lodge Mountains provides mesic habitat and supports late successional forests and major deciduous cover in addition to pine. Four community types are significant: Ponderosa pine/Bur Oak Woodland (Pinus ponderosa/Quercus macrocarpa Woodland), Ponderosa pine/Rough-leaf Ricegrass Woodland (Pinus ponderosa/Oryzopsis asperifolia Woodland), Paper birch/Beaked Hazel Forest (Betula papyrifera/Corylus cornuta Forest), and Bur oak/Ironwood Forest (Quercus macrocarpa/Ostrya virginiana Forest).
